This guide is for the City of Goodyear, Arizona, not the Goodyear tire company. Goodyear bulk trash pickup in 2026 is monthly and address-based. Your home is assigned to a “1st through 4th weekday” bulk day, such as 1st Monday, 2nd Tuesday, 3rd Wednesday or 4th Friday. A 5th weekday is never assigned for bulk pickup.

For the safest result, check your address in Goodyear’s Waste Wizard calendar, place bulk material in the street next to the curb in front of your property, keep items away from utilities and landscaping, cut objects to 4 feet, and have everything out before 6:00 a.m. on your scheduled bulk day.

How Goodyear Bulk Trash Pickup Works in 2026

Goodyear bulk trash is for normal residential material that is too large for the regular trash or recycling container. It is not a construction debris service, hazardous waste pickup, tire pickup or unlimited cleanout program.

  1. Confirm your exact address schedule. Open the City’s trash, recycling and bulk pickup page and use the Calendar tab. You can print a schedule or sign up for reminders.
  2. Write down your monthly pattern. Your home may show something like 1st Monday, 2nd Wednesday or 4th Friday. That pattern is more useful than a generic “bulk week.”
  3. Prepare large items before set-out. Cut objects to 4-foot lengths. Bag grass clippings correctly. Box cactus or sharp glass items and label the box to protect workers.
  4. Place the pile in the street next to the curb. Use the area in front of your property. Keep the pile away from electrical boxes, cable boxes, mailboxes, poles, water meters and landscaping.
  5. Use the correct set-out window. The cleanest habit is after 6:00 p.m. the day before pickup. The City allows set-out up to seven days before the scheduled bulk day.
  6. Have it out before 6:00 a.m. A late pile may not be serviced. After pickup, residents are responsible for cleaning small debris left behind.

Weekly Goodyear Garbage and Recycling Pickup

Weekly cart service is separate from monthly bulk trash. Goodyear partners with Waste Connections of Arizona for same-day residential trash and recycling container collection. The tan garbage container and green recycling container are serviced once per week on the same day.

Goodyear Bulk Trash Rules: Placement, Size and Safety

Bulk pickup is a safety-sensitive service. Crews need items that can be reached, lifted, cut correctly, boxed when sharp, and separated from rejected materials.

Do this

Correct Goodyear bulk setup

  • Confirm your monthly bulk day in Waste Wizard.
  • Place items in the street, next to the curb, in front of your property.
  • Keep material away from electrical boxes, cable boxes, mailboxes, poles, water meters and landscaping.
  • Cut objects to 4-foot lengths.
  • Double bag grass clippings or place them in sealed cardboard boxes.
  • Place cactus, glass items and cutting-edge items in sealed boxes and clearly label them.
  • Set out after 6:00 p.m. the day before pickup, or within the City’s allowed seven-day window.
  • Have items out before 6:00 a.m. on your scheduled collection day.
Do not include

Rejected items that can stop pickup

  • Household trash that fits in your regular container.
  • Hazardous materials, chemicals, paint, motor oil and solvents.
  • Large auto parts, tires and boats.
  • Rocks, dirt, mulch and landscaping fill material.
  • Large glass items such as windows, doors and tabletops.
  • Construction, repair or demolition debris such as roofing, drywall and concrete.
  • Material placed in a way that blocks pedestrians or vehicles.
  • Late set-out after 6:00 a.m. on collection day.
Move-out and estate cleanout reality

A garage cleanout, rental turnover or estate cleanup can easily exceed the normal bulk limit. Do not build a huge pile first and ask questions later. Use the landfill section, private hauler, dumpster or phased monthly disposal plan before the pile becomes a neighborhood problem.

Large Items in Goodyear: What Goes Where?

This section answers the real “can I put this out?” searches. When an item is questionable, use Waste Wizard or call Utilities Customer Service before dragging it to the curb.

Item or material Best Goodyear route Resident action
Sofa, chair, dresser, table, furniture Monthly bulk pickup Place at the curb/street edge for your scheduled bulk day. Keep away from utilities and obstacles.
Mattress or box spring Monthly bulk pickup Use your assigned bulk day. Do not block sidewalks or travel lanes.
Appliances Retailer pickup or bulk day When replacing appliances, arrange store pickup where possible. Otherwise check Waste Wizard and bulk day guidance.
Branches, wood and tree trimmings Bulk pickup if prepared correctly Cut to 4-foot lengths. Keep the pile manageable and safe for crews.
Grass clippings Bulk only if double bagged or boxed Double bag or place in sealed cardboard boxes.
Cactus or sharp yard material Bulk only if boxed and labeled Use sealed boxes and clearly label to prevent worker injury.
Paint, solvents, pool chemicals, pesticides HHW appointment or drop-off option Do not place in bulk, trash or recycling unless the City’s HHW rules say otherwise.
Lithium-ion or rechargeable batteries HHW pickup or approved battery vendor Never put rechargeable batteries in trash, recycling or bulk collection.
Window, glass door, tabletop glass Not regular bulk pickup Large glass items are listed as not accepted for bulk collection.
Drywall, roofing, concrete, repair debris Landfill, dumpster or private disposal Construction repair or demolition material is not regular bulk trash.
Dirt, rocks or mulch Not bulk pickup Use approved disposal or landscaping material handling. Do not place in bulk pile.
Tires, oil, large auto parts, boats Not bulk pickup Use another approved disposal route. Do not leave these for City bulk collection.
Simple sorting rule

Before bulk day, make four piles in your mind: accepted bulk, regular weekly trash, HHW, and landfill/private disposal. If you mix those piles together, pickup can fail.

Household Hazardous Waste in Goodyear: Paint, Batteries, Oil and Chemicals

Residents searching for “Goodyear bulk trash paint,” “battery disposal near me,” “motor oil disposal,” or “pool chemicals pickup” should not use the bulk pile. Goodyear has seasonal residential HHW pickup appointments and a year-round drop-off option through ACTEnviro for eligible customers when pickup is closed or materials exceed pickup limits.

Pickup events

Appointment required

HHW pickup is available to Goodyear sanitation customers with an active account. The City limits pickup to one per residence per seasonal event.

Limits

20 lb household limit

Goodyear lists a 20 lb total weight limit, 10 gallons for paints and liquids, and no single container larger than 5 gallons for HHW pickup.

Drop-off

ACTEnviro option

If pickup scheduling is closed or material exceeds the pickup weight limit up to the drop-off allowance, call ACTEnviro at 602-842-9160 for appointment directions.

Accepted HHW examples

Use HHW instead of bulk

  • Aerosol cans.
  • Antifreeze and automotive fluids.
  • Car batteries, oil and filters.
  • Fire extinguishers.
  • Gasoline in a certified container.
  • Household cleaners.
  • CFLs and fluorescent tubes in labeled boxes.
  • Oil-based paint, latex paint, pesticides, pool chemicals and propane tanks.
Not accepted in HHW

Still needs another route

  • Ammunition or explosives.
  • Appliances.
  • Medical waste of any kind.
  • Landscape waste.
  • Radioactive materials.
  • Tires.

When Bulk Trash Is Not Enough: Landfill and Transfer Station Options

Goodyear residents may dispose of large items at listed landfill or transfer station locations, and fees may apply. This is useful for oversized cleanouts, items not suited for curbside pickup, and projects that cannot wait for the monthly bulk day.

Location Address / phone Resident note
Waste Connections Transfer Station 3000 S. 19th Ave. • 480-983-9101 Show proof of Goodyear residency for Goodyear rate. No tires accepted. Electronic waste accepted.
City of Glendale Municipal Landfill 11480 W. Glendale Ave. • 623-930-2191 Show proof of Goodyear residency for Goodyear rate. No tires accepted. Electronic waste accepted.
White Tank Transfer Station 18605 W. McDowell Rd. • 623-853-1707 Call before driving to confirm hours, fees and accepted materials.
Southwest Regional Landfill 24427 S. State Route 85 • 623-393-0085 Useful for larger disposal planning; confirm load and material rules first.
Landfill warning

Goodyear’s landfill information lists several items that may not be accepted at landfill sites, including HHW, paint, chemical by-products, unused pesticides, radioactive waste, medical waste, used oil, fuel, batteries and refrigerant appliances unless proper certification is provided.

Goodyear Holiday Trash Pickup 2026

Goodyear’s 2026 holiday schedule says trash, recycling and bulk collection occur one day later when your normal pickup day falls on Thanksgiving Day, Christmas Day or New Year’s Day 2027. Other listed 2026 holidays do not affect service.

Holiday 2026 service impact Resident action
Thanksgiving Day — Thursday, Nov. 26, 2026 If your normal pickup is on this date, service occurs the next day. Check Waste Wizard before setting out carts or bulk material that week.
Christmas Day — Friday, Dec. 25, 2026 If your normal pickup is on this date, service occurs the next day. Set a phone reminder because Friday service may move to Saturday.
New Year’s Day — Friday, Jan. 1, 2027 If your normal pickup is on this date, service occurs the next day. Check again near year-end because it crosses into the next calendar year.
MLK Day, Presidents Day, Memorial Day, Juneteenth, Independence Day, Labor Day, Veterans Day Goodyear lists normal trash, recycling and bulk pickup on these holidays. Still verify address schedule if the City posts a weather, route or service alert.

Goodyear Bulk Trash and Garbage Pickup FAQ

When is Goodyear bulk trash pickup in 2026?

Goodyear bulk trash is monthly and assigned by address as a 1st, 2nd, 3rd or 4th weekday of the month. Use the City’s Waste Wizard calendar to find your exact date.

Does Goodyear collect bulk trash on a 5th weekday?

No. The City says bulk pickup is never assigned on a 5th weekday of the month, such as a 5th Monday or 5th Tuesday.

What time should Goodyear bulk trash be out?

Have bulk material out before 6:00 a.m. on your scheduled collection day. Material set out after 6:00 a.m. may not be serviced.

How early can I place bulk trash outside in Goodyear?

The cleanest set-out time is after 6:00 p.m. the day before collection. The City also says bulk material may be set out up to seven days before the scheduled bulk collection day.

How big can my Goodyear bulk trash pile be?

Goodyear says each bulk accumulation, except furniture and appliances, should not exceed five cubic yards and should be shaped so two employees can safely lift it without breaking.

Where should I place bulk trash in Goodyear?

Place bulk trash in the street next to the curb in front of your property. Keep it away from electrical boxes, cable boxes, mailboxes, poles, water meters and landscaping.

Can furniture and mattresses go in Goodyear bulk trash?

Common bulky household items such as furniture and mattresses are typically the kind of material bulk pickup is meant for, as long as they are placed correctly and not mixed with rejected items.

Can I put construction debris in Goodyear bulk trash?

No. Goodyear lists construction repair or demolition material such as roofing materials, drywall and concrete as not accepted for bulk collection.

Can I put paint, oil, batteries or chemicals in Goodyear bulk trash?

No. Use Goodyear’s household hazardous waste program or approved drop-off guidance for paint, automotive fluids, pool chemicals, rechargeable batteries and similar materials.

Are Goodyear trash and recycling picked up on the same day?

Yes. Goodyear says trash and recycling containers are serviced once a week on the same day, though collection times may vary.

Which 2026 holidays delay Goodyear trash pickup?

Goodyear lists one-day-later service for Thanksgiving Day 2026, Christmas Day 2026 and New Year’s Day 2027 when your normal pickup falls on those dates.

Who do I call for Goodyear bulk trash help?

Call Utilities Customer Service at 623-882-7887 for bulk trash collection questions. The Public Works Department also lists 623-932-3010 Option 4 for department contact.
